They are a perfect way to compliment your table with out covering it completely like you may do with a tablecloth.
No! There is no need for that here, say for instance that you have a beautiful wood grain table that really looks the part in your home and you would like just way to serve food on to protect the wood without covering up that would grain.
Table runners.
That is what you would use in this situation, they act as the perfect go between providing protection for your table while doing it in a classy, elegant and stylish way.
But, you may have been fooled into thinking with popular culture and all that the table runner is predominantly for the table.
This is not the case, a table runner is also suitable to other pieces of furniture found in home.
Pieces like a dresser, side board cabinet, coffee tables, why not push the boat out a little bit here? As ever in contemporary design the only thing that is the barrier is you and your creativity.
The most style of table runner available today is known as Shabby Chic, this can be described as an elegant and relaxed style that is clearly very vintage.
Which the majority of high street stores not selling this popular and now in demand style, you would be more authentic in purchasing it from a local vintage or second hand store.
